From Montreynaud to Saint Chamond by bus and light rail
To get from Montreynaud to Saint Chamond in Saint-Étienne, you’ll need to take 2 bus lines and one light rail line: take the M9 bus from Montreynaud station to Place Carnot station. Next, you’ll have to switch to the T2 light rail and finally take the M5 bus from Jean Moulin station to Lamartine station. The total trip duration for this route is approximately 1 hr 5 min.
